| 1909 | Aiko Yamano was born on 20 January |
| 1925 | Opened Yamano Hair Salon in Mukoujima, Tokyo |
| 1934 | Opened Yamano Beauty Training Centre in Nihonbashi, Tokyo |
| 1934 | Introduced perm techniques for the first time in Japan |
| 1949 | Established Yamano Beauty High School (now known as Yamano Beauty College) |
| 1954 | Appointed as the CEO of Japan Beautician Association |
| 1960 | Commended by the Minister of Health and Welfare(Merit Recognition for Public Health) |
| 1961 | Established Yamano Beauty College in Los Angeles, USA |
| 1961 |
Appointed as one of the judges for Miss International and Miss World |
| 1963 | Appointed as the CEO of the All Japan Beautician Association Opened DORONKO full body beauty salon |
| 1967 | Received RANJYU medal with blue ribbon |
| 1969 | Appointed as Vice President, International Cultural Association |
| 1971 | Established Yamano Kimono Dressing School |
| 1971 | Established Yamano Beauty Mate |
| 1980 | Received the Order of the Sacred Treasure Gold Rays with Neck Ribbon |
| 1985 | Appointed as Jury President for Miss International and Miss World |
| 1986 | Established Yamano Clesty Academy (now known as Yamano Esthetic Academy) |
| 1988 | Awarded the Society and Cultural Merit by Japan Cultural Council |
| 1991 | Received an award from Japan’s Cultural Administrator (for her contributions towards developing a culture of beauty) |
| 1992 | Opened Yamano Beauty and Art College |
| 1995 | Passed away at the age of 86 |
